Position: History Full-Time 9/10 Month Tenure Track Faculty

Overview

Title: History Full-Time 9/10 Month Tenure Track Faculty

Anticipated

Start Date:

August 2026

School: School of Social Sciences, Education, and Human Services

Department: Social Sciences

Type of Appointment: Full-Time

FLSA Status: Exempt

Required Documents

Required Documents Needed to Upload at Time of Application: Cover Letter, Resume, transcripts and three professional references.

Reference check requirements: Three (3) professional references, two (2) of which should be former or current supervisors and one professional reference. Personal references (friends, clergy, customers, relatives) are not considered acceptable references.

Work Details

Work Schedule: 5 days a week; 37.5 hours per week with 30 hours on campus; meetings as needed; travel to multiple campuses; night or weekend classes; alternative delivery of classes (e.g., web, web-hybrid, cohort, accelerated); no guarantee of summer sections

Job Objective: To teach and develop non-U.S. HISTORY courses while furthering the goals of the program, department, college, and community college system

Essential Job Functions
  • 65%

    A. TEACHING:
    Develop and teach non-U.S. HISTORY courses to a diverse student population using traditional and alternative delivery formats (hybrid, web, cohort, accelerated). Prepare course syllabi, course materials, evaluate student learning and maintain class records.
  • 20%

    B. SERVICE/OUTREACH:
    Participate in program/curriculum development and assessment, student advising, department meetings, and college boards and committees. Perform related duties as assigned
  • 15%

    C. PROFESSIONAL DEVELOPMENT:
    Participate in continuing professional development to improve teaching, evaluation of student learning and classroom technique.

Note: The College reserves the right to change or reassign job duties or combine positions at any time.

Non-Essential Functions

Marginal tasks performed include the operation of standard office equipment such as computer and copy machines.

Job Standards
  • A. Master’s Degree in History from a regionally accredited institution.
  • B. 18 graduate semester hours in non-U.S. History
  • C. Additional knowledge of and experience teaching U.S. History survey preferred.
  • D. Minimum one-year related teaching experience at the postsecondary level
  • E. Understanding and acceptance of the comprehensive community college philosophy.
Critical Skills/Experience
  • A. Demonstrated competence teaching survey-level history courses in a traditional face-to-face classroom.
  • B. Experience teaching survey courses in early and modern World and/or Western history preferred.
  • C. Experience teaching in a community college preferred.
  • D. Ability to communicate effectively and establish and maintain interpersonal relationships.
  • E. Expertise in curriculum development is required.
Job Location

Candidates should be prepared to teach at any of the college's four campuses as needed. Accordingly, travel between sites may be required.

Equipment

Some use of telephone, computer equipment, overhead projector, fax machines and other standard office equipment is required. Facility with computer communication systems and visual aid production a must.
